首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

运行psql命令时,获取psql的符号查找错误

可能是由于以下原因导致的:

  1. 未正确安装psql:首先,确保已正确安装了psql工具。psql是PostgreSQL数据库的命令行工具,用于与PostgreSQL数据库进行交互。您可以从PostgreSQL官方网站下载并安装适合您操作系统的版本。
  2. 环境变量配置错误:在运行psql命令之前,需要将psql的安装路径添加到系统的环境变量中。这样操作系统才能正确找到psql命令。您可以通过在命令行中输入"psql"来检查是否能够正确执行psql命令。如果无法执行,可能需要检查环境变量配置是否正确。
  3. 数据库连接配置错误:当运行psql命令时,需要提供正确的数据库连接信息,包括数据库主机地址、端口号、用户名和密码等。请确保这些信息正确无误,并且与您要连接的数据库相匹配。
  4. 数据库权限问题:如果您使用的是非管理员用户连接数据库,可能会遇到权限不足的问题。请确保您使用的用户具有足够的权限来执行所需的操作。

针对以上问题,您可以参考以下腾讯云产品和文档链接来解决:

  1. 腾讯云PostgreSQL数据库:腾讯云提供了托管的PostgreSQL数据库服务,您可以使用该服务来轻松管理和使用PostgreSQL数据库。了解更多信息,请访问:腾讯云PostgreSQL
  2. 腾讯云云服务器CVM:腾讯云提供了强大的云服务器CVM,您可以在上面安装和配置psql工具,并执行相关操作。了解更多信息,请访问:腾讯云云服务器CVM
  3. 腾讯云数据库连接指南:腾讯云提供了详细的数据库连接指南,您可以按照指南中的步骤配置正确的数据库连接信息。了解更多信息,请访问:腾讯云数据库连接指南

请注意,以上链接仅为示例,您可以根据实际情况选择适合您的腾讯云产品和文档。同时,建议您在遇到问题时查阅相关文档和寻求专业人士的帮助,以获得更准确和全面的解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用 psql 列出 PostgreSQL 数据库和表

在管理PostgreSQL数据库服务器,您可能要执行最常见任务之一就是列出数据库及其表。 PostgreSQL附带了一个名为psql交互式工具,允许您连接到服务器并对其运行查询。...在使用psql,还可以利用它命令。这些命令对于脚本编写和命令行管理非常有用。所有元命令都以非引号反斜杠开头,也称为反斜杠命令。...要以 “postgres” 用户身份访问终端 psql ,请运行: sudo -u postgres psql 该 sudo 命令允许您以其他用户身份运行命令。...前两个是创建新数据库使用模板。 如果要获取有关数据库大小,默认表空间和描述信息,请使用 \l+ 或 \list+ 。仅当当前用户可以连接到数据库,才会显示数据库大小。...要获取有关表大小信息,请使用说明 \dt+。 结论 您已经学习了如何使用该 psql 命令列出 PostgreSQL 数据库和表。

4.2K10

数据库PostrageSQL-备份和恢复

SQL转储 SQL 转储方法思想是创建一个由SQL命令组成文件,当把这个文件回馈给服务器,服务器将利用其中SQL命令重建与转储状态一样数据库。...默认情况下,psql脚本在遇到一个SQL错误后会继续执行。...你也许希望在遇到一个SQL错误后让psql退出,那么可以设置ON_ERROR_STOP变量来运行psql,这将使psql在遇到SQL错误后退出并返回状态3: psql --set ON_ERROR_STOP...作为另一种选择,你可以指定让整个恢复作为一个单独事务运行,这样恢复要么完全完成要么完全回滚。这种模式可以通过向psql传递-1或–single-transaction命令行选项来指定。...在使用这种模式,注意即使是很小一个错误也会导致运行了数小时恢复被回滚。但是,这仍然比在一个部分恢复后手工清理复杂数据库要更好。

2.1K10
  • 后台查找CDSW中用户审计日志

    ,这里我们需要在运行众多容器中找出提供DB服务容器,可以通过如下两种方式来查找docker和kubectl命令 1.使用docker命令找出当前正在运行容器 [root@cdsw ~]# docker...2.使用kubectl命令查看当前正在运行容器 [root@cdsw ~]# kubectl get pods (可左右滑动) ?...通过上述两个命令可以找到正在运行DB服务Docker容器,获取到相应容器ID和NAME,在后面访问需要使用到。...3.访问正在运行Docker容器 ---- 1.前面找到了真正运行DB服务Docker容器,接下来我们需要进入正在运行DB容器,访问方式对应上面的查找方式也是有两种 使用docker命令访问,这里要使用前面获取...使用kubectl命令访问,需要使用前面获取Name访问 [root@cdsw ~]# kubectl exec -ti db-74df8c56d9-p7lbq -- /bin/sh (可左右滑动)

    70720

    【云原生进阶之数据库技术】第三章-PostgreSQL-管理-2.2-运维操作

    # \q或exit 2.2 数据库操作 2.2.1 查看psql命令列表 ?...必须以对要备份数据库具有读取权限用户身份运行命令: 以postgres用户身份进行登录 [root@client ~]# su - postgres 通过运行以下命令将数据库内容转存到文件中...在默认情况下,PostgreSQL将忽略备份过程中发生任何错误,这可能导致备份不完整,要防止这种情况,可以使用-1选项运行pg_dump命令。...(超级用户除外) replication 做流复制用到一个用户属性,一般单独设定 password 在登录要求指定密码才会起作用,跟客户端链接认证方式有关 inherit 用户组对组员一个继承标志...表名 WHERE 字段 IS NULL; (15)从表某行开始获取N条数据,一般通过该命令实现分页功能 以下语句表示:从表t_host0行开始获取20条数据。

    14410

    在macOS上安装&配置PostgreSQL

    postgres psql工具/命令行 需要使用-d参数指定数据库进入 需要使用-U参数指定用户进入,且需要输入密码 不同Homebrew版本产生安装以及数据目录可能会有差异~ 2、Homebrew...PATH="/Library/PostgreSQL/15/bin:$PATH"' >> ~/.zshrc source ~/.zshrc 三、PostgreSQL基础使用 PostgreSQL提供了在命令行下运行数据库连接工具...psql,我们可以通过psql命令行执行内部命令管理数据库,也可以执行SQL,做用户管理增删改查等操作 # 指定用户连接PostgreSQL psql -U postgres # 指定数据库连接PostgreSQL...psql -d postgres # 参数参考 psql -h 127.0.0.1 -p 5432 -U ken -d postgres 1、常用psql命令 # 查看所有用户 \du # 查看所有数据库...PRIVILEGES ON DATABASE test TO test; 四、PostgreSQL远程访问 1、账户与数据目录 PostgreSQL程序文件以及数据文件默认属于postgres账户/brew安装账户

    10.9K34

    win10安装PostgreSQL12.6

    ,选择第二个为删除单个组件,而保留安装其余应用程序 三、验证安装 1、查看版本 先进入postgresql安装路径bin目录,cmd执行 psql --version 2、初始化数据库 initdb.exe...psql -p 5432 -U postgres 如果出现以下报错是因为安装没有成功创建用户,需要手动创建 psql: 错误: 致命错误: 角色 "postgres" 不存在 cmd命令行进入安装目录...bin目录下执行以下命令,创建postgres用户 createuser -s -r postgres psql -p 5432 -U postgres 四、添加postgis依赖 1、下载postgis...pgsql意外错误导致服务异常关闭 C:\Users\com>psql -p 5432 psql: 错误: 无法联接到服务器: Connection refused (0x0000274D/10061...) 服务器是否在主机 "localhost"(::1) 上运行并且准备接受在端口 5432 上 TCP/IP 联接?

    1.9K30

    HAWQ技术解析(六) —— 定义对象

    例如,运行下面的命令将连接HAWQ主机并创建名为db3数据库,主机名和端口号必须与HAWQmaster节点相匹配。...修改数据库         ALTER DATABASE命令可以用于修改数据库缺省配置,如下面的命令修改search_path服务器配置参数,改变数据库db1缺省模式查找路径。...系统模式         使用psql\dn元命令查看当前连接数据库所有模式。...*元命令列出该模式下视图。这些视图以标准方式从系统目录表获取系统信息。 pg_toast:存储大小超过页尺寸大对象。这个模式被HAWQ系统内部使用。...视图并不物化到磁盘,当访问视图,查询作为一个子查询运行。HAWQ不支持WITH子句内嵌视图和物化视图。 1.

    2.9K50

    PostgreSQL基础(三):PostgreSQL基础操作

    ​PostgreSQL基础操作只在psql命令行(客户端)下,执行了一次\l,查看了所有的库信息。可以直接基于psql查看一些信息,也可以基于psql进入到命令行后,再做具体操作。...可以直接基于psql去玩可以输入psql --help,查看psql命令 可以直接进入到命令原因,是psql默认情况下,就是以postgres用户去连接本地pgsql,所以可以直接进入。...下面的图是默认连接方式后面都基于psql命令行(客户端)去进行操作命令绝对不要去背,需要使用时候,直接找帮助文档,在psql命令行中,直接注入\help,即可查看到数据库级别的一些命令 \?...create database root;可以在不退出psql前提下,直接切换数据库 。也可以退出psql,重新基于psql命令去切换用户以及数据库。如果要修改用户信息,或者删除用户,可以查看。...\c laozheng -laozheng -- 报错:-- 致命错误: 对用户"-laozheng"对等认证失败-- Previous connection kept-- 上述方式直接凉凉,原因是匹配连接方式

    32020

    数据库PostgreSQL-安装

    访问数据库 一旦你创建了数据库,你就可以通过以下方式访问它: 运行PostgreSQL交互式终端程序,它被称为psql, 它允许你交互地输入、编辑和执行SQL命令。...作为超级用户意味着你不受访问控制限制。 对于本教程目的而言, 是否超级用户并不重要。 如果你启动psql碰到了问题,那么请回到前面的小节。...诊断createdb方法和诊断psql方法很类似, 如果前者能运行那么后者也应该能运行。...比如,你可以用下面的命令获取各种PostgreSQLSQL命令帮助语法: mydb=> \h 要退出psql,输入: mydb=> \q psql将会退出并且让你返回到命令行shell。...(要获取更多有关内部命令信息,你可以在psql提示符上键入?。) psql完整功能在psql中有文档说明。在这份文档里,我们将不会明确使用这些特性,但是你自己可以在需要时候使用它们。

    3.5K20

    Linux 上安装 PostgreSQL

    注意:我这里才用是默认安装方式,就使用find命令查找了一下postgresql.conf配置位置,然后进行修改: 1 [root@slaver1 /]# find -name postgresql.conf...把这个配置文件中认证 METHODident修改为trust,可以实现用账户和密码来访问数据库,即解决psql: 致命错误: 用户 "postgres" Ident 认证失败 这个问题)。 ?...=# 登录进去默认界面,命令提示符前面的就是当前数据库,使用 \l 查看当前数据库列表,如下所示: 1 [root@slaver1 ~]# psql -h 192.168.110.133 -d...很多初学者都会遇到psql -U username登录数据库却出现“username ident 认证失败”错误,明明数据库用户已经createuser。...;     d、如果希望从任何地方都可以访问PostgreSQL数据库,就将该配置项设置为“*”;   通过ident描述可以看到上面出现错误(解决psql: 致命错误: 用户 "postgres"

    6.4K10

    从零开始学PostgreSQL (六): 备份和恢复

    文件系统级备份 文件系统级备份 是一种物理备份技术,涉及在数据库停止服务(或在某些情况下,使用 pg_start_backup 和 pg_stop_backup 命令在 PostgreSQL 运行时)...1.1 恢复转储 恢复pg_dump创建数据库转储通常涉及以下步骤和注意事项: 1、恢复命令: 文本转储文件通常通过psql命令读入,其基本形式为: psql -U postgres -h 127.0.0.1...4、错误处理: 默认情况下,psql在遇到SQL错误时会继续执行脚本,但你可以通过设置ON_ERROR_STOP变量为on,使psql在第一个错误出现时就停止执行并退出,退出状态码为3。...这可以通过psql--single-transaction选项实现。但要注意,任何错误都会导致整个恢复操作回滚。...3、备份标签和表空间映射:备份标签文件包含了关于备份会话重要元数据,如标签字符串、运行时间和起始WAL文件名。表空间映射文件记录了表空间符号链接信息,这对于恢复过程至关重要。

    19610

    PostgreSQL入门和高维向量索引

    sudo -i -u postgres 执行后提示符会变为 ‘-bash-4.2$',再运行 同构执行进入 psql 进入postgresql命令行环境。...输入上面命令以后,系统会提示输入dbuser用户密码。输入正确,就可以登录控制台了。 psql命令存在简写形式。...比如,假定存在一个叫做ruanyf数据库,则直接键入psql就可以登录该数据库。 psql 另外,如果要恢复外部数据,可以使用下面的命令。...要使用该选项,服务器编译必须使用--with-openssl选项,并且在服务器启动ssl设置是打开,具体内容可见这里。...peer 获取客户端操作系统用户名并判断他是否匹配请求数据库名,这只适用于本地连接。 ldap 使用LDAP服务进行验证。 radius 使用RADIUS服务进行验证。

    1.7K30

    互联网厂工必知必会:SQL基础篇

    #windows ② 运行安装程序 运行安装程序时候,鼠标右键点击安装文件,然后选择“以管理员身份运行”。...注意 如果错误地停止了“postgresql-x64-9.5”之外其他服务,可能会造成操作系统无法正常工作,所以请一定不要停止其他服务。...输入安装设置密码,按下回车键,然后就会在命令提示符窗口显示出“postgres=#”,意味着连接成功了(图 0-15)。 ?...图0-19 从 PostgreSQL 登出 注意 现在通过 psql 连接(登录)是安装 PostgreSQL 自动创建示例数据库 postgres。...为了连接刚刚创建数据库,我们需要暂时结束(退出)psql。由于 psql 在窗口关闭也会结束,因此也可以通过点击 psql 窗口右上角“X”按钮结束 psql

    1.4K40

    初探向量数据库pgvector

    作为大型语言模型如腾讯混元大模型重要辅助,它利用矢量表示数据并通过测量这些矢量之间相似度以找到相关结果。这将获取相关信息速度和准确度提升至新高级。...-p 5432:5432 -d ankane/pgvector 使用psql构建库表 psql --help psql是PostgreSQL 交互式客户端工具。...=STRING 为不整齐输出设置字录分隔符(默认:换行符号) -t, --tuples-only 只打印记录i -T, -...查看所有数据库列表 要查看当前数据库中所有数据库列表,可以使用以下 SQL 命令: \l 在 psql 命令行中执行这个命令会显示所有数据库列表,包括数据库名、所有者、编码、描述等信息。...可以通过以下两种方式之一运行它: \d \dt 上面的命令将显示当前数据库中所有表列表。它显示表名、表类型(例如表、视图等)、拥有者以及其他信息。

    3.8K40

    数据结构——复杂度和顺序表

    在用代码实现算法前时候就已经估算出时间复杂度和空间复杂度了 时间复杂度 只讲解如何计算 在计算时间复杂度时候,只考虑程序或者算法中关键部分大概运行次数。我们用大O表示法。...大O表示法 1.只保留高次项(增长速率最快)并且高次项系数改成1 2.所有常数项均为1 3.可以含有多个未知元,如:O(m+n) 4.最好运行次数与最差运行次数平均次数。...(一般只关注最差情况) log n其实是以2为底对数,以其他为低数都要写出来,比如log₃n 空间复杂度 完成某一个算法需要额外开辟空间,也是用大O表示法。其求法和时间复杂度求法类似。...>size++; } 头删 注意没有有效数时候,即psql->size等于0时候 cvoid SeqListPopFront(SeqList* psql) { assert(psql);...+ 1]; i++; } psql->size--; } 查找 找到返回下标,找不到返回-1。

    14910

    PostgreSQL - psql使用汇总

    PostgreSQL连接数据库两种方式 PostgreSQL在安装自带了pgAdmin和psql,pgAdmin是可视化工具,psql命令行工具。...先登陆psql控制台,再连接指定数据库 psql命令也可以不指定某个数据库,如下: 1 psql -h -p -U 这时候登陆成功后会进入...psql命令台,此时可以跑一些数据库备份、创建数据库或者连接数据库之类操作。...很简单,还是跑这个\c命令即可。 退出psql控制台 和其他命令行工具不一样,psql在退出并不是使用exit,而是使用\q,接着按下回车就行了,这里q指就是quit。...运行SQL文件 方式一:连接db后执行SQL文件 首先通过psql连接到对应db: 1 psql -d db1 -U userA 接着输入密码,进入数据库后,输入: 1 \i /pathA/xxx.sql

    2K40

    Mac配置postgresql容器并连接

    配置本机psql环境安装psql(以15版本为例)brew install postgresql@15配置环境变量echo 'export PATH="/opt/homebrew/opt/postgresql...可通过如下命令测试psql是否安装成功psql -d postgres如出现如下内容,代表安装成功,输入exit退出数据库即可。...POSTGRES_DB=testdb -e POSTGRES_PASSWORD=vin -p 20000:5432 postgres参数说明:-it -d 这两个参数一般同时使用,保证 container 以交互方式在后台运行...命令查看运行容器出现类似结果代表容器启动成功CONTAINER ID IMAGE COMMAND CREATED STATUS...端口-U 数据库用户名,需要和上面创建容器制定用户名相同-W 在运行命令后会要求输入密码-d 指定连接数据库名-h 指定连接主机ip,这里由于是本机docker需要指定为localhost图片

    1.5K40
    领券